Any amyotrophic lateral sclerosis in which the cause of the disease is a mutation in the VAPB gene.
Features include always present findings: Postural tremor; and very common findings: Muscle spasm, Fasciculations, and Proximal muscle weakness. 19 total HPO annotations.

Amyotrophic lateral sclerosis type 8 is caused by mutations in the VAPB gene on chromosome 20.
Genetic testing for VAPB is available. Testing is considered confirmatory for diagnosis.
